The Role of Quinoa in Breakfast Bars
Explanation of quinoa’s protein and fiber content. Benefits of incorporating quinoa into breakfast.Quinoa is a tiny power-packed grain found in breakfast bars. It brings lots of protein and fiber to the table. One cup of cooked quinoa has about 8 grams of protein and 5 grams of fiber, making it a winning ingredient. These nutrients help keep you full and energized. Incorporating quinoa into your breakfast means starting your day right. It can boost your mood and readiness for the day ahead!

Step-by-Step Guide to Making Breakfast Bars
Detailed instructions for preparation. Tips for customizing flavors and textures.First, gather your ingredients! You’ll need sunflower seeds, quinoa, oats, honey, and your favorite mix-ins like dried fruits or chocolate chips.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Then, in a big bowl, mix the quinoa, oats, and seeds together. Add in the honey and any extras. Now, spread the mixture into a lined baking pan, like spreading icing on a cake! Bake for about 20 minutes until golden. Let them cool, then slice and enjoy. Think of all the fun flavors you can add: maybe some nuts or even a touch of cinnamon. Your snack will be healthy and tasty!
Ingredient | Amount |
---|---|
Sunflower Seeds | 1 cup |
Cooked Quinoa | 1 cup |
Oats | 1 cup |
Honey | 1/2 cup |
Mix-ins (dried fruits or chocolate chips) | 1/2 cup |

Storing and Serving Suggestions
Best practices for storing breakfast bars. Creative serving suggestions for breakfast or snacks.Storing breakfast bars keeps them fresh and tasty. Wrap them in plastic or foil. This helps prevent them from getting hard. Keep the bars in an airtight container. Store them in the fridge for longer shelf life. You can also freeze them for up to three months!

Can You Provide A Step-By-Step Guide On How To Make Homemade Breakfast Bars Using Sunflower Seeds And Quinoa?Sure! Here’s how you can make homemade breakfast bars with sunflower seeds and quinoa: 1. First, cook 1 cup of quinoa according to the package instructions. Let it cool. 2. In a bowl, mix the cooked quinoa with 1 cup of sunflower seeds. 3. Add 1 cup of oats, ½ cup of honey, and a pinch of salt. Mix well. 4. Press this mixture into a baking pan lined with parchment paper. 5. Bake at 350°F (175°C) for about 20 minutes. Let it cool, then cut into bars. Enjoy!
